Prince William and Kate Middleton Reject Entitlement Attitude

Advertisement

Prince William and Kate Middleton are often scrutinized for their alleged privilege. However, an expert argues that this perception is unfounded.

Royal biographer Russell Myers told Marie Claire that both Prince William and Kate have worked hard to understand the monarchy’s role in society.

Myers explained that it took over a decade for them to grasp the current state of the monarchy and its future direction.

The expert also noted that those who’ve been exposed to misconduct often develop a sense of entitlement. Myers believes this is why there are no reports of such behavior from William and Kate, or any claims against them.
